List of UK Universities Offering Fully Funded Scholarships for International Students in 2026

Below is a list of universities in the UK currently offering or expected to offer fully funded scholarships to international students in 2026. Always visit the official university website to confirm current availability and deadlines.

  1. University of Oxford – Rhodes Scholarship

Website: https://www.rhodeshouse.ox.ac.uk One of the oldest and most competitive scholarships in the world, the Rhodes Scholarship covers full tuition, accommodation, and a personal allowance for postgraduate study at Oxford. It is open to students from over 60 countries.

  1. University of Cambridge – Gates Cambridge Scholarship

Website: https://www.gatescambridge.org Funded by the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, this scholarship is awarded to outstanding applicants from outside the UK for full-time postgraduate study at Cambridge. It covers tuition, a maintenance allowance, and more.

  1. UK Government – Chevening Scholarships

Website: https://www.chevening.org Chevening is the UK government’s flagship international scholarship programme. It offers fully funded one-year master’s degree scholarships to future leaders from across the world. Over 160 countries are eligible.

  1. Commonwealth Scholarships

Website: https://cscuk.fcdo.gov.uk Funded by the UK government, Commonwealth Scholarships are for students from Commonwealth nations who wish to pursue postgraduate study. They cover tuition, flights, and living expenses.

  1. University of Edinburgh – Global Scholarships

Website: https://www.ed.ac.uk/student-funding/postgraduate/international Edinburgh offers a range of scholarships for international students at undergraduate and postgraduate levels. Many cover full tuition and some include a maintenance grant.

  1. University of Manchester – President’s Doctoral Scholar Award

Website: https://www.manchester.ac.uk/study/postgraduate-research/funding This award supports exceptional PhD students with a full scholarship covering fees and a generous annual stipend for living costs.

  1. Imperial College London – President’s Scholarships

Website: https://www.imperial.ac.uk/study/pg/fees-and-funding/scholarships Imperial College offers fully funded PhD scholarships in science, technology, engineering, and medicine for outstanding international applicants.

  1. University of Leeds – Faculty Scholarships

Website: https://scholarships.leeds.ac.uk Leeds offers competitive scholarships across multiple faculties for both postgraduate taught and research students. Awards vary and many cover full tuition fees.

  1. University College London (UCL) – Scholarships

Website: https://www.ucl.ac.uk/scholarships UCL offers numerous scholarship opportunities for international students across all levels of study. Their Denys Holland Scholarship and Faculty Excellence Awards are especially notable.

  1. University of Warwick – Warwick Chancellor’s International Scholarship

Website: https://warwick.ac.uk/study/postgraduate/funding/warwick-chancellor-international-scholarship This scholarship is for PhD students and covers full tuition fees plus a living stipend. It is highly competitive and open to international students in all disciplines.

Why Study in the United Kingdom?

The United Kingdom has long been considered one of the best places in the world to receive a higher education. Here are some compelling reasons why students from every corner of the globe choose the UK:

World-Ranked Universities: The UK is home to some of the most prestigious universities globally – Oxford, Cambridge, Imperial College London, and University College London (UCL) consistently appear at the top of global rankings.

Shorter Programme Duration: Unlike other countries where a master’s degree takes two years, most UK master’s programmes are completed in just one year — saving you time and money.

Multicultural Environment: The UK is incredibly diverse. You will study and live alongside people from over 100 different countries, building a global network that can benefit your career for decades.

Post-Study Work Visa: After completing your studies, the UK Graduate Route Visa allows you to stay and work in the UK for up to two years (three years for PhD graduates), giving you international career experience.

Quality of Life: From historic cities and modern infrastructure to excellent public transport and healthcare access, life in the UK offers comfort, safety, and a stimulating cultural experience.

Research and Innovation: The UK invests heavily in research and development. Students gain access to cutting-edge labs, libraries, and academic resources that push the boundaries of knowledge.

How to Apply for UK Scholarship Application 2026

Applying for a UK scholarship does not have to be overwhelming. Follow these steps to improve your chances:

Step 1 – Choose Your Scholarship Research the scholarships listed above and identify the one that best fits your academic background, field of study, and career goals.

Step 2 – Check Eligibility Read the eligibility requirements carefully. Confirm you meet the academic qualifications, language requirements, and any other criteria.

Step 3 – Prepare Your Documents Common documents include academic transcripts, a personal statement, letters of recommendation, a valid passport, and language test scores (e.g., IELTS or TOEFL).

Step 4 – Write a Strong Personal Statement Your personal statement is your chance to stand out. Be honest, specific, and passionate. Explain why you want to study in the UK, what you hope to achieve, and how you plan to use your education to make a difference.

Step 5 – Submit Your Application Online Visit the official scholarship or university website, complete the application form, upload your documents, and submit before the deadline.

Step 6 – Prepare for Interview (if required) Some scholarships include an interview stage. Practice answering questions about your field of study, your goals, and your understanding of current issues in your area of interest.
